Tech Coalition Pathways

Pathways is the Tech Coalition's no-cost capacity-building programme for eligible employees of non-member companies handling user content or communications. Launched on 18 July 2024, it offers guidance, resources and licensing opportunities intended to strengthen companies' response to online child sexual exploitation and abuse.

Participation, services and separate entitlements

The operator's December 2025 account reports 67 participant companies, five resources and two fireside chats. Applicants undergo eligibility and registration review and agree to published access and confidentiality conditions. Membership is neither required nor guaranteed. Accepted participants may apply for a PhotoDNA sublicense, which remains a separate approval; participation also does not imply Lantern access. The Coalition's paid Elevate advisory service is distinct from Pathways and from the Christchurch Call Foundation's separately named Elevate programme.
